=Have you heard these words before, "The value of what we don't have is greater than when we have it."? Ruminate over it for some time and draw your conclusions. Is the statement true or not?
Do you know that what you are hungry for now will lose its gripping value to you, no sooner than you get it?
No wonder then that the man of wealth, King Solomon rightly observed and declared," Vanity of vanity, all is vanity." Ecclesiastes 12:8 KJV.
This was the case with the Jews during their journeys in the wilderness where the Lord God of their fathers was leading them by the hand of Prophet Moses.
When they were hungry, the Lord their God chose to feed them with Angels' food which they never knew nor their fathers.
After a while, the lust of their flesh ceased to value nor appreciate the Lord's provision called Manna.
In their words,
"But now our soul is dried away: there is nothing at all, besides this manna, before our eyes." Numbers 11:6, KJV.
Because they failed to appreciate further the provision of God, Manna depreciated. It meant nothing to them any longer. They went to the extent of weeping and longing for something else.
It is not a sin to desire something else or more but their approach was very wrong.
How?
*They failed to appreciate the Lord's provision that met their feeding need, the Manna.
*They saw nothing but the Manna. If The Lord provided Angels food to feed them, He was readily available to satisfy their request if properly presented before Him.
*Weeping was brought into the matter as if the Lord had always neglected them without caring for them. This was not so and it was wrong for them to think in that line.
Beloved, the Lord was angry with them, and His faithful Servant, Moses, was equally displeased.
Do you know that the Jews in the wilderness were and still are a replica of mankind in general and the people of God in particular?
Do you appreciate what the Lord has done for you or given you? Please, do. As you appreciate His kindness and blessings to you, prayerfully present your needs to Him and patiently wait for Him to satisfy you with them.
Therefore, do not provoke the Lord to anger by murmurings or grumbling. Appreciate His provision and ask for what you want more. Do not allow the lust of the flesh to influence or force you to sin against the Lord your God. Stay blessed and prepared for the imminent coming of the Lord.
